How are alleles represented in genetic inheritance?

Alleles are different forms of a gene that can be inherited from each parent. In genetic inheritance, alleles are represented by letters, with uppercase letters denoting dominant alleles and lowercase letters denoting recessive alleles. Each individual inherits two alleles for each gene, one from each parent, which determine their genetic traits.

When the two alleles of a gene are the same, what term is used to describe this genetic condition?

When the two alleles of a gene are the same, this genetic condition is called homozygous.

How are alleles and mutations linked in the context of genetic variation and inheritance?

Alleles are different forms of a gene that can result from mutations. Mutations are changes in the DNA sequence that can create new alleles. These new alleles can lead to genetic variation, which can affect inheritance patterns in offspring.
